Mary Berry Passion Fruit & Orange Cheesecake Recipe

This Mary Berry Passion Fruit & Orange Cheesecake Recipe is a creamy no-bake dessert made with a buttery biscuit base, rich cream cheese filling, fresh passion fruit, and bright orange flavours. It is easy to prepare, beautifully refreshing, and perfect for family gatherings, celebrations, or summer desserts.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Chill Time 4 hours
Total Time 4 hours 30 minutes
Servings: 8 people
Course: Cake, Dessert
Cuisine: british
Calories: 420

Ingredients
  

For the Base
  • 200 g digestive biscuits or Graham crackers
  • 100 g unsalted butter melted
For the Filling
  • 500 g full-fat cream cheese
  • 100 g caster sugar
  • 300 ml double cream
  • Zest of 1 orange
  • 3 tbsp fresh orange juice
  • Pulp of 3 passion fruits
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 2 tsp powdered gelatine or 2 gelatine leaves
  • 3 tbsp warm water
For the Topping
  • Pulp of 2 passion fruits
  • 1 tbsp icing sugar optional
  • Orange zest
  • Fresh orange slices optional

Method
 

  1. Crush the digestive biscuits and mix with melted butter.
  2. Press the mixture into a lined 20cm springform tin and chill for 30 minutes.
  3. Dissolve the gelatine in warm water and allow it to cool slightly.
  4. Beat the cream cheese and caster sugar until smooth.
  5. Add the orange zest, orange juice, vanilla extract, and passion fruit pulp.
  6. Whip the double cream to soft peaks and gently fold it into the filling.
  7. Stir in the dissolved gelatine until fully combined.
  8. Pour the filling over the chilled biscuit base and smooth the top.
  9. Refrigerate for at least 4 hours or overnight until fully set.
  10. Decorate with passion fruit pulp, orange zest, and fresh orange slices before serving.

Notes

  • Use full-fat cream cheese for the smoothest texture.
  • Dissolve the gelatine completely before adding it to the filling.
  • Chill the cheesecake overnight for the cleanest slices.
  • Fresh passion fruit provides the best flavour and appearance.
  • Do not overwhip the cream, or the filling may become grainy.
  • Keep the cheesecake refrigerated until serving.
  • Decorate just before serving for the freshest presentation.
  •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ge.
